The San Francisco 49ers are an American football team located in the San Francisco Bay Area. The team plays in the West Division of the National Football Conference (NFC) in the National Football League (NFL). The team was founded in 1946 as a charter member of the All-America Football Conference (AAFC) and joined the NFL in 1949 after the two leagues merged. In 2014, the team relocated to Levi's Stadium in Santa Clara, after playing at Candlestick Park in San Francisco from 1971 to 2013. The original home of the 49ers from 1946 to 1970, Kezar Stadium, is in the southeast corner of San Francisco's Golden Gate Park.
